On Sat, Apr 12, 2014 at 10:01:54AM +0200, Christoph Hellwig wrote:
> This series is a major overhaul of the filestream allocator. The main point
> is to use the dcache to get the parent and avoiding to maintain a fstrm_item
> for each inode that the filestream is applied to in favor of just tracking
> the parent, but there's various more or less related fallout from this as well.
OVerall it looks good. I'll need to do some testing on it and
have a deeper look at the main use-the-dentry-cache patch, but it
removes a heap of complexity and code and gets rid of the use of
inode IO locks, so there's a loot to like here...
